
Barcelona coach Xavi Hernandez has admitted that his side don’t deserve to play in the Champions league and this comes after their draw with Inter Milan.
Barcelona needed a must win when they faced Inter Milan on when Wednesday to keep their hopes of advancing into the round of sixteen on of this years campaign.
Barcelona scored first in the first half through Ousmane Dembele and they managed to go on the break with a nil advantage.
Inter Milan managed to score two quick goals in the second half to take the lead before Robert Lewandowski equalized for the host in the 82nd minute of the game.
Inter Milan scored what seemed to be a winner in the 89th minute when goalkeeper Andre Onana managed to pass the the ball to Lautaro Martinez who assisted Robin Gosens to score what was to be a winner.
Robert Lewandowski scored in 90nd minute of the match to salvage a three-all draw and this results has for now kept the spanish giants chances of qualifying to the round off 16 alive.
In other group C encounter Bayern Munchen wired Viktoria Plzen with a scoreline of 4 goals to 2
